TrackingTime vs Hubstaff

Pricing

The difference starts before the first paid tier: Hubstaff has no free plan and a 2-seat minimum, while TrackingTime is free for unlimited users. From there, TrackingTime costs less at every level, and it doesn’t charge à la carte for task management, GPS or extra screenshots.

TrackingTimeHubstaff
Free$0, unlimited usersNo free plan (14-day trial)
Entry paidStarter $4.50 (annual)Starter $4.99 (annual)
MidPro $6.75 (annual)Grow $7.50 (annual)
AdvancedPro Plus $8.50 (annual)Team $10 (annual)
TopBusiness $12 (annual)Enterprise $25 (annual)
Task managementIncluded+$2.50/seat add-on

Honest take

When Hubstaff might still be the better fit.

We’d rather be honest than oversell. Hubstaff earns its place for teams built around a different kind of workforce.

Workforce monitoring is the goal

Screenshots, activity levels and proof-of-work make sense for remote contractors, BPOs or offshore teams, and Hubstaff is purpose-built for it.

Field teams need GPS

GPS tracking and geofencing that clock crews in and out at job sites make Hubstaff strong for construction, delivery and field service.

Contractor payroll is a priority

Native payout integrations move money to a distributed contractor workforce, keeping global payroll straightforward.

Is TrackingTime cheaper than Hubstaff?

Yes, at every tier, and it doesn’t charge add-ons. Hubstaff has no free plan, a 2-seat minimum, and bills extra for task management and GPS. TrackingTime’s Business plan ($12) costs less than half of Hubstaff Enterprise ($25), and its free plan supports unlimited users.

Does Hubstaff have a free plan?

No. Hubstaff offers a 14-day free trial with a 2-seat minimum, but no free plan. TrackingTime’s free plan supports unlimited users with time tracking, project management and reporting.
